Crossovers Expanded, Volume 3 is a huge chronology of crossover tales in which characters, situations, or universes from a wide variety of fictional works, are linked together in order to form a vast and diverse Crossover Universe.

Compiled by crossover and Wold Newton expert Sean Lee Levin, Crossovers Expanded, Volume 3 includes more than 1,000 crossover tales, as well as many timeline entries charting the wider history of the Crossover Universe.

From ancient times, and into the Twenty-first Century, and beyond to the far-flung future…

. . . When Conan met Wonder Woman; Rocambole teamed up with Zatoichi in Japan; the Lone Ranger crossed paths with Paladin, the Cartwright boys, and more; Dracula’s daughter married a Talbot; Phileas Fogg had an adventure in Ruritania; Sherlock Holmes matched wits with Dr. Caligari; Dr. Fu Manchu gave Dr. Herbert West some eggs from Skull Island; Bruce Hagin Rassendyll combated Dr. Meirschultz and his Lazarus Cabal; Irma Vep dueled with Filibus; Sexton Blake came to the aid of the Count of Monte Cristo’s grandson; Professor Challenger time traveled alongside the Nyctalope; Secret Agent X fought off Murder Legendre’s zombie gangsters; the rookie Green Lama worked with the Black Bat; Detective Sergeant Frederick Troy played cards with James Bond; the Rocketeer was helped out of a jam by Indiana Jones; the Avenger and the Domino Lady battled villains together on more than one occasion; Reed Richards investigated the Giant Rat of Sumatra; Batman and Robin teamed up with John Steed and Emma Peel; Maigret, Ellery Queen, Hercule Poirot, and Kogoro Akechi crossed paths with Arsène Lupin; Doc Caliban and Doc Wildman had a cross-dimensional meeting; the Six Million Dollar Man fought COBRA alongside G.I. Joe; Sludge ran into Carl Kolchak’s niece; Tabitha Lenox revealed her past relationship with Barnabas Collins; the Drood family went to war with the Nightside; Cassie Hack and Vlad encountered the Crow; Repairman Jack fought Madame de Medici and was introduced to a former agent of The Shadow; a Morley Cigarettes package was spotted in Twin Peaks, Washington; the Librarians crossed swords with the Phantom of the Opera’s descendant in Paris; Jack Reacher and Will Trent shared an adventure; Charlie Chan’s great-grandson had a run-in with the Cthulhu Mythos; Aym Geronimo visited Nero Wolfe’s old brownstone; and Joe Ledger encountered Hap and Leonard, as well as Travis McGee’s daughter . . .

With a new Foreword by Keith Howell (pop culture expert and cover artist for Crossovers Expanded, Volumes 1–3), Crossovers Expanded, Volume 3 also includes many book and magazine covers, as well as appendices covering a myriad of alternate universe tales, parodies, and farces which don’t fit into the primary Crossover Universe continuity, and covering the latest references in Kim Newman’s Anno Dracula series!
